Longtime catering business near Chicago’s Midway Airport catches fire overnight

0 20

Emergency services are on the scene after a catering establishment caught fire near Midway International Airport on Thursday night, authorities confirmed.

An alarm fire was reported at the 6300 block of South Central Avenue at 11:35 p.m. Thursday, according to Chicago Fire officials. Crews worked overnight and into early Friday morning, officials said.

Photos and video from the scene show firefighters on ladders using hoses to douse the flames in what appears to be a scorched and blackened building.

Officials said no injuries or displacement were reported.

The catering company at this address, Georgi’s Catering, has been in business for over 50 years, providing meals to dozens of executive services such as large corporations and corporations, airplanes and yachts, Meals on Wheels, and many more, the website says.

NBC 5 reached out to Georgi’s Catering for comment, but didn’t hear back.
